Basic StructuresArrays & Hashes
<input id="person_name" name="person[name]"
type="text" value="Henry"/>
params hash{‘person’ => {‘name’ => ‘Henry’}}
params[:person]{‘name’ => ‘Henry’}
params[:person][:name]‘Henry’
Nested Hashes
<input id="person_address_city"
name="person[address][city]"
type="text" value="New York"/>
params hash{'person' => {'address' => {'city' => 'New York'}}}
Duplicated Params
<input name="person[phone_number][]" type="text"/>
<input name="person[phone_number][]" type="text"/>
<input name="person[phone_number][]" type="text"/>
params[:person][:phone_number][ ’02-333-1234’, ‘031-323-9898’, ‘062-546-2323’]

Using Form Helpers
<%= form_for @person do |person_form| %> <%= person_form.text_field :name %> <% @person.addresses.each do |address| %> <%= person_form.fields_for address, :index => address do |address_form|%> <%= address_form.text_field :city %> <% end %> <% end %><% end %>
<form accept-charset="UTF-8" action="/people/1" class="edit_person" id="edit_person_1" method="post"> <input id="person_name" name="person[name]" size="30" type="text" /> <input id="person_address_23_city" name="person[address][23][city]" size="30" type="text" /> <input id="person_address_45_city" name="person[address][45][city]" size="30" type="text" /></form>
address.id
Using Form Helpers
{ 'person' => { 'name' => 'Bob', 'address' => { '23' => {'city' => 'Paris'}, '45' => {'city' => 'London'} } }}
